Transaction 5ca61b32ffe64ad77ad58fb38136d909574870ad694eb4209da628f8bb4593ab
1 Input
1 Output
-
5ca61b32ffe64ad77ad58fb38136d909574870ad694eb4209da628f8bb4593ab:0
- value
- 541416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57266db8513a3fe7f61ff5b07e973e1ecb4a8935 OP_EQUAL
- address
- 39dpkJGQhranUTeVPdqiSG8NuRyuX7weZt